Hayes is slated to open the 2016-17 season on the Bruins' third line with Matt Beleskey, centered by Austin Czarnik.
EDGE Analysis
Hayes, who finished the 2015-16 season with 13 goals and 29 points to go along with a minus-12 rating in 75 games, is only an option in deeper formats, as long as he remains on the Bruins' third line. If injuries down the road usher him into a top-six role or power play duty, Hayes could emerge as a lineup option, but the 6-foot-5, 215-pounder has much to prove in his second season as a Bruin.
